Как создать игру танки в Scratch — подробный мастер-класс для начинающих

Программирование - это увлекательное занятие, которое способно развить мышление и логику. При этом, создание собственной игры может стать настоящим испытанием для начинающего программиста. Если вы хотите попробовать свои силы и сделать свою первую игру, то с использованием Scratch это вполне реально!

Скетч (Scratch) - это блок-программа, которая позволяет создавать игры, анимации и интерактивные приложения без необходимости изучения программирования на сложных языках. Игра "Танки" - это одна из самых популярных и простых игр для начинающих. Чтобы ее создать, вам потребуется всего несколько шагов и немного творческого подхода.

Первым шагом в создании игры "Танки" в Скетче будет создание спрайтов танка и игрового поля. Вы можете нарисовать собственные спрайты или использовать готовые из библиотеки Scratch. Затем, вы сможете задать им нужные характеристики: скорость передвижения, повороты и др. Кроме того, разработайте игровое поле, добавив препятствия и объекты, с которыми танк будет взаимодействовать.

Далее, вам нужно будет настроить управление танком с помощью клавиш на клавиатуре. Для этого используйте блоки программирования в Скетче, которые отвечают за обработку нажатий клавиш. При нажатии на кнопки "вверх", "вниз", "влево" или "вправо", ваш танк должен перемещаться соответствующим образом на игровом поле.

Важные шаги для создания игры "Танки" в программе "Scratch"

Важные шаги для создания игры "Танки" в программе "Scratch"

Создание своей собственной игры в программе "Scratch" может быть увлекательным и освоением новых навыков программирования. Если вы хотите создать игру "Танки", вам понадобятся некоторые важные шаги для достижения этой цели. Вот несколько шагов, которые помогут вам в этом процессе:

  1. Задумайтесь о механике игры - определите, каким образом игрок будет управлять танком, какие будут его движения и стрельба. Размышлите также о врагах и их поведении.
  2. Создайте спрайты - используйте графический редактор в "Scratch" для создания спрайтов для танка, врагов и других игровых объектов. Уделите внимание деталям и убедитесь, что все спрайты соответствуют нужной тематике.
  3. Определите правила игры - опишите, как игрок будет набирать очки, что произойдет при столкновении танка с врагом или при срабатывании условий для победы или поражения.
  4. Сделайте программирование - используйте блоки программирования в "Scratch" для создания логики игры. Реализуйте движение танка, его стрельбу, поведение врагов и другие аспекты игрового процесса.
  5. Добавьте звуки и визуальные эффекты - дополните игру звуковыми эффектами, музыкой и другими аудиоэлементами. Используйте анимации и специальные визуальные эффекты для создания более привлекательного игрового опыта.
  6. Проверьте и настройте игру - тестируйте игру, чтобы убедиться, что все работает в соответствии с вашими ожиданиями. Внесите необходимые настройки и исправления, чтобы улучшить игровой процесс.
  7. Опубликуйте игру - поделитесь своей игрой с другими пользователями "Scratch". Загрузите ее на платформу "Scratch" или предоставьте ссылку на свой проект, чтобы другие люди могли насладиться вашей созданной игрой.

Создание игры "Танки" в программе "Scratch" может быть увлекательным и творческим процессом. Следуя этим важным шагам, вы сможете создать интересную и захватывающую игру для себя и других пользователей.

Подготовка к проекту и создание игрового поля

Подготовка к проекту и создание игрового поля

Прежде чем приступить к созданию игры танки в Scratch, необходимо провести некоторую подготовительную работу. Сначала нужно определить основные правила и цели игры. Затем следует создать игровое поле, на котором будет развиваться действие.

Для начала рекомендуется создать новый проект в Scratch и настроить его параметры под нужды вашей игры. Затем необходимо определить размеры игрового поля. Обычно игровое поле в играх танки имеет прямоугольную форму. Вы можете выбрать любой размер поля, важно лишь принять решение исходя из концепции вашей игры.

Далее следует создать элементы игрового поля. Основным элементом в игре танки является танк. Его можно создать с помощью спрайта, предоставляемого самим Scratch, или загрузить свой собственный спрайт. Также можно создать спрайты для препятствий, уровня игры и других объектов, которые будут взаимодействовать с танком. Помимо этого, не забудьте создать спрайт для пуль, которые будет выстреливать танк.

После создания спрайтов нужно разместить их на игровом поле. Сделать это можно с помощью блока "установить позицию" в блоках программирования Scratch. Расположите танк и препятствия на поле так, чтобы они не перекрывали друг друга и не затрудняли движение танка. Определите начальные координаты танка и других элементов, а затем задайте им позицию на игровом поле.

После того, как игровое поле создано и спрайты размещены, остается только добавить логику игры. Для этого нужно создать скрипты, которые будут определять поведение танка и других объектов на поле. Помимо этого, можно добавить звуки и эффекты, чтобы сделать игру более интересной и захватывающей.

Теперь часть подготовки к проекту и создание игрового поля завершены. Остается только приступить к программированию и разработке остальной части игры, чтобы сделать ее максимально захватывающей и увлекательной для игроков.

Создание спрайтов и настройка их поведения

Создание спрайтов и настройка их поведения

Перед созданием спрайтов следует определить их внешний вид и поведение. Например, спрайт танка может выглядеть как прямоугольник со специфичной окраской или содержать изображение реального танка. Важно чтобы спрайт был различим на экране и соответствовал общему стилю игры.

После определения внешнего вида спрайтов можно приступить к их созданию в редакторе Scratch. В редакторе можно выбрать готовые спрайты из библиотеки или создать новый спрайт с пустого холста и нарисовать его самостоятельно.

После создания спрайта необходимо настроить его поведение. В Scratch поведение спрайтов определяется через блоки программирования, которые задают способность спрайта перемещаться, сталкиваться с другими спрайтами или реагировать на действия игрока.

Например, для танка можно задать возможность перемещаться вперед и назад при нажатии определенных клавиш на клавиатуре или через блоки программирования. Также можно задать логику обработки столкновений с другими спрайтами или преградами на игровом поле.

При создании спрайтов и настройке их поведения важно учесть все возможные сценарии игры и предусмотреть все необходимые блоки программирования для реализации логики игры танки.

Разработка игровой логики и добавление основных функций

Разработка игровой логики и добавление основных функций

При разработке игры "Танки" на платформе Scratch необходимо создать основную игровую логику и добавить основные функции. Чтобы игра была интересной и увлекательной, необходимо продумать следующие аспекты:

  1. Управление танком. Необходимо добавить функции, позволяющие игроку перемещать танк по полю боя. Для этого можно использовать клавиши на клавиатуре или специальные кнопки на экране.
  2. Столкновение с препятствиями. Чтобы создать эффект столкновения танка с препятствием, нужно проверить, не пересекается ли он с каким-либо объектом на поле боя. Если танк сталкивается с препятствием, необходимо ограничить его движение или изменить направление.
  3. Стрельба. Чтобы танк мог стрелять, необходимо добавить функцию, которая будет выпускать снаряд в заданном направлении. Для реализации этой функции нужно создать спрайт снаряда и задать ему начальное положение и скорость.
  4. Уничтожение танков. Для создания функции уничтожения танков необходимо проверять, пересекается ли снаряд с танком. Если да, то танк должен исчезнуть с поля боя, а игрок должен получить определенное количество очков.

При разработке игровой логики и добавлении основных функций, важно следить за плавностью и корректностью их работы. Также стоит сделать игру более интересной и разнообразной, добавив различные уровни сложности, бонусы и препятствия на поле боя.

Оцените статью